Parliament, Monday, 16 October 2023 – The Portfolio Committee on Small Business Development invites interested individuals and relevant stakeholders to submit written comments and indicate interest in making oral submissions on the National Small Enterprise Amendment Bill [B16-2023].

Primarily, the Bill seeks to, amongst others, provide for the disestablishment of the Small Enterprise Financing Agency, the Co-operative Banks Development Agency and the Small Enterprise Development Agency and make provision for the establishment and registration of the Small Enterprise Development Finance Agency (SEDFA), as well as the establishment of the Office of the Small Enterprise Ombud Service.

Furthermore, it makes provision for the Minister to declare certain practices in relation to small enterprises to be prohibited as unfair trading practices and make regulations; provide for the transitional arrangements necessitated by the establishment of SEDFA; and to effect consequential or necessary amendments to the Co-operative Banks Act of 2007, as well as the Co-operatives Act of 2005.
